    During the monsoon, naturopathy and yogic principles suggest that our digestive fire weakens, urging us to eat light and support our body's natural detox processes. Naturopathy recommends warm, light, and hydrating meals like steamed vegetables and herbal teas to aid digestion. Yogic practices can further enhance digestive Agni, promoting inner stillness and overall well-being.

    TrendingMental health remains a neglected area in India, particularly among men, due to cultural expectations of strength and stoicism. The pressure to be primary providers and maintain family honor further silences men, while inadequate mental health infrastructure exacerbates the issue. Growing awareness and advocacy are gradually breaking down barriers, emphasizing the need for a cultural shift and accessible resources.
